I made an appointment to watch a play, and all the titles came out. Half-time, the children were still laughing, crying, crying, and arguing that they couldn't find a place, and those who were taught by their parents kept pouting. As soon as Astro Boy in red boots came out, all the children laughed and went quiet. But this movie, which tells the story of a cute child with human emotions who was abandoned by his father and the world, and then used violence to save the world, was mixed with all kinds of killings and conspiracies. Why would anyone want to show a child such a horrible movie? ? ?



Because they have both the capacity to commit violence and child protection laws? ? ?



When I was a child, I saw Nezha, who was in the sky, was beaten to death by his father, and he didn't sleep for a few days. Trust me, it was the scariest horror movie in the world.
